雷达余数定理,又称为欧拉定理,是数论中的一个重要定理。它揭示了整数除法中余数与原数、除数之间的一些有趣的关系。本文将深入探讨雷达余数定理的奥秘,并分析其在各个领域的应用。
雷达余数定理的起源与证明
雷达余数定理最早可以追溯到古希腊时期,由数学家欧拉提出。定理的内容如下:
设 ( a ) 和 ( n ) 是两个正整数,且 ( n ) 是一个合数。如果 ( a ) 与 ( n ) 互质,即它们的最大公约数为 1,那么 ( a^{\phi(n)} \equiv 1 \pmod{n} ),其中 ( \phi(n) ) 表示 ( n ) 的欧拉函数。
欧拉定理的证明有多种方法,其中一种常用的证明方法是利用费马小定理。费马小定理指出,如果 ( p ) 是一个质数,( a ) 是一个与 ( p ) 互质的整数,那么 ( a^{p-1} \equiv 1 \pmod{p} )。
雷达余数定理的应用
雷达余数定理在密码学、计算机科学、数学等领域有着广泛的应用。
密码学
在密码学中,雷达余数定理被广泛应用于公钥密码体制的设计。例如,RSA密码体制就是基于欧拉定理的。在RSA体制中,选择两个大质数 ( p ) 和 ( q ),计算它们的乘积 ( n = pq ),然后计算 ( n ) 的欧拉函数 ( \phi(n) )。用户可以选择一个与 ( \phi(n) ) 互质的整数 ( e ) 作为公钥,并计算 ( d ) 作为私钥,使得 ( ed \equiv 1 \pmod{\phi(n)} )。这样,当用户接收到的信息经过加密后,可以使用私钥 ( d ) 进行解密。
计算机科学
在计算机科学中,雷达余数定理被用于快速计算幂模运算。例如,在计算 ( a^b \pmod{n} ) 时,可以利用欧拉定理将指数 ( b ) 分解为 ( b = k \cdot \phi(n) + r ),其中 ( k ) 和 ( r ) 是整数。然后,根据欧拉定理,有 ( a^b \equiv a^r \pmod{n} )。这样,只需要计算 ( a^r \pmod{n} ) 即可。
数学
在数学中,雷达余数定理被用于解决一些数论问题。例如,在求解同余方程 ( ax \equiv b \pmod{n} ) 时,可以利用欧拉定理将方程转化为 ( a^{\phi(n)}x \equiv b^{\phi(n)} \pmod{n} )。然后,根据欧拉定理,有 ( a^{\phi(n)}x \equiv 1 \pmod{n} )。这样,可以将原方程转化为 ( x \equiv b^{\phi(n)} \pmod{n} )。
总结
雷达余数定理是数论中的一个重要定理,它在密码学、计算机科学、数学等领域有着广泛的应用。通过深入理解雷达余数定理的奥秘,我们可以更好地解决实际问题,为科学技术的进步贡献力量。
